The club aims to expand both its senior
and junior memberships as a main activity
to support promotion of participation in
amateur rowing. For seniors, Ihe club offers
membership lo experienced or retuming
rowers and runs leam-tO•row courses lor
novices. For juniors, the club runs outreach
to local schools. runs leam-tt>row course5
for juniors and supports junior rowing from
J12 (12-year olds) through to J18 (18-year
olds).
The only restrictions on membership are
those of medical (X)ndilions which impact
Ihe ability of an individual to row safely.
The club aims to support assisted rowing
where il can but this is limited by the nature
of the facilities.

North Staffs Rowtng Club was first listed by
the Charity Commission on 27 De￿mber
2021 but existed as a private members club
for approximately 40 years prior to Ihis.
The club's year end has Iradilionally been
30 Seplember and this will be retained in
order to allow members to see a like-for-
like comparison of finances. However, this
means that the first annual report submitted
to the Charity Commission will only cover a
period of approximately 9 months.
Furthemiore. as this is the firsi year of the
charity's existence. there are no previous
submissions against which to Compare but
narrative comparisons may be made with
pre-¢harity finances.
The charity's bank balance at year end VMS
£11.3k which was 6.30/0 lower than at the
stsrt of the reporb'ng period.
The main source of income is membership
subscriptions which have increased
through the year due to an increase in
membership numbers. In addition,
coaching fees from Keele University Boat
Club have resumed posl-COVID.
Infflation has resulted in upward pressure
on both fixed expenditu￿ (rent is linked to
RPI} and variable expenditure particularly
mainlenants. Discretionary expenLlilure is
primarily purchase of new equipment which
varies signfficantly yearvon-year.
The dublcharity's bank balan￿ has been
in general dedine over recent years mainly
due lo a reduction in grants available for
purchase of new equipmenl, ￿dUCed
Income during ihe pandemic and lattet1y
higher inflation. H{￿ever, they are slill
considered lo be in a sustainable position.
Membership fees have recenuy been
increased for the first time in 5 years and
the trustees support Ihe increased
emphasis on fundraising.

The trustees in consullalion with the
Treasurer have decided that a minimum
sum of£10-15K be retained in order to
cover fixed outgoings (rent and insurance)
for a period of at least one year in the event
of an unforeseen cessabon or redUct￿n in
activity.
